Finished the series earlier in the week & I'm happy and sad all at once.


It was an amazing journey (one I kind of want to re-experience sooner than later )


I'm going to keep it short because I have to say it was all a whirlwind once this RanVijay business got messy. Then Vijaya came along, and it was like "oh boy," then "okay, it's shaping up," and then it went back to "oh man, when are the Shekawats leaving Rajawat gharana??"


RanVijay track - okay, there was potential here to really delve into the family dynamics and strengthen relationships, but I don't know why they dragged it so long. It also felt like they lost track of the plot and shifted Ranvijay from obsessed father to Vijaya's pawn at the last minute. They had no idea what to do with him because the story got so draggy and skewed. It also highlighted how Rani doesn't really share a lot of her issues/plans with anyone. Lack of communication has been a major issue for RanVeer and only sheer faith & understanding in one another kept them from major problems. 


Jai & RanVijay - ugh, really? How was that brushed under the rug with "Jai was blackmailed?"


Vijaya & Suraj - psycho people are entertaining, but they toned it down because it was a little all over the place and too much after RanVijay. Also, I feel like Ranvijay was ended a little oddly. What about his life pre-coma? He said he had married and has his own property. That he wanted Veer to be his heir... then it all randomly changed. It was so odd. They also made him seem like a problem in the past, but we never got anecdotes of how Ranvijay was problematic. With Vijaya's entry, RanVijay's entire series of episodes and emotions were negated with the reasoning that "RV wanted to help Vijaya usurp Rajawat house." Like what? But it was okay bc I think that phase in the show needed to just be over.


There were a lot of good subplots in the Vijaya track BUT the problem was that it was one person continuously winning and creating all these problems. By the end of it, I felt for Vijaya. She seemed like a child led down the wrong path, I guess. Someone who wanted belonging. She became close and affectionate to those that treated her well. Overall, if the story continued, a well-written realization and redemption track could have been scripted for her. Also, a track where Suraj's spoilt self gets therapy and a better attitude. 


My issue with the Vijaya track is once again ...it dragged. It was one person doing too many things. They could have freshened it up with other random entries creating problems & the Rajawat's working against them. Another annoying thing they continued with was Rani being secretive. I'm glad Veer clearly told her that he felt like a loser or a failure because Rani couldn't trust him. That she didn't share her plan with him. I'm also annoyed that Vikram and Rajmata immediately doubted Rani bc they know her. They know Rani's nature compared to RaniSa - so, how did they think Rani could ever go against them?!
